An SIMD type microprocessor is disclosed. The SIMD type microprocessor includes plural PEs (processor elements) each of which provides an ALU (arithmetic and logic unit) for lower-order bits, an ALU for upper-order bits, a control circuit for lower-order bits, a control circuit for upper-order bits, a range determining circuit for lower-order bits, and a range determining circuit for upper-order bits. The SIMD type microprocessor further includes a global processor, a range designation bus for lower-order bits which connects the global processor to the range determining circuit for lower-order bits, and a range designation bus for upper-order bits which connects the global processor to the range determining circuit for upper-order bits. The global processor instructs the range determining circuits to designate corresponding ranges to be operated on by the corresponding ALUs via the corresponding range designation buses so that the ALU for lower-order bits and the ALU for upper-order bits can be operated separately.
